The Lung Cancer Score in 19150,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ania is 58 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

62.86 percent of the population in 19150 drive to work alone. 23.75 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 31.34 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 16.41 percent of the residents in 19150 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.13 members with about 1.55 cars available per household.

An estimate of 92.20 percent of the residents in 19150 has some form of health insurance. 45.45 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 63.21 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 19150 would have to travel an average of 2.20 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Chestnut Hill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 19150,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

As of , an estimate of 22,760 residents live in 19150 with a median age of 44.5 years. 17.57 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 23.86 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.97 percent of the residents in 19150 is currently married, and 24.58 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 19150 is $5,751.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 19150 is approximately $1,099. The median household spends about 19.11 percent of their income on housing.
